Hi April,

 

For the wedding I have been working with Dreams WC, Rebeca. She has been great so far, replying to emails within 24 hours. I have not had any other communication with the hotel.

 

I used a TA that I would NOT recommend. She has been a hassel to say the least, with no negotiating experience what so ever. Our TA went through Pleasant Vacations to book our rooms since we didn't have the $100 per room deposit required if blocking rooms at the hotel. Through Pleasant each guest had to put down a $150 deposit.

 

Yes, Rebeca did say that I am getting my wedding package for free as well I am getting the honeymoon package for booking so many rooms. I decided I did not need a lot of the extras that came with the other two packages and would be going off site for decorations and flowers. I was supposed to have the ceremony at 4:30 but I was ordering my invites so I doubled checked with Rebeca and she told me that time of year, it is typically good to start at 4:00. You figure pics start around 4:30ish and she sun sets between 5:30-6 so that gives us one hour of photos in daytime - but of course, I do want sunset pics too, so I'm just trusting her on this one, but I think it's just your preference.
